Subject: DR drill follow-up — flaky DNS on Mistral stack

Hi Priya,

The drill surfaced that intermittent resolver issue again: the Mistral stack's internal DNS flapped during failover, delaying cutover by nine minutes. Torben patched the resolver config on the standby. To close out the drill, the resolver vault was re-keyed, and its recovery passphrase is recorded just below.

vault phrase of kawep-tahog = ulaix-briath

Runbook: checkout load test — for Wednesday's sync

Quick fragment for the CartSprint checkout flow at Pellbrook Retail. We hammer staging with 5k virtual shoppers, ramping over ten minutes, and watch p95 on the payment-intent step. If it creeps past 800ms, abort and ping the platform channel — don't just rerun and hope. The load harness pulls signed scenario bundles from the artifact store, so rebuilt scenarios need re-signing before the run. The key the harness expects is:

deploy key for kajof-fajop: bky6_gDHw9Q

Heads up, support crew — the Fernbright password reset flow got revamped this week. Users now get a six-digit code instead of the old magic link, and the code expires in ten minutes. If someone says the code never arrived, check the delivery queue in Resolva before escalating. For accounts stuck in the legacy flow, you'll need to trigger a manual recovery from the admin panel. Use this passphrase when the panel prompts you:

vault phrase of bagaf-kajeg = jorath-feniel-briir-siliel-ralix

/*
 * Client setup for the Pinwheel artifact service.
 * Policy reminder for reviewers: every dependency here is pinned to an
 * exact version and checksum — no ranges, no "latest". Upgrades go
 * through the weekly bump PR so the SBOM stays honest and we can bisect
 * regressions fast. If you see a floating version sneak in, flag it;
 * that's a build-reproducibility break, not a style nit.
 * The client authenticates to Pinwheel's internal registry with the key below.
 */

gateway credential: kto23_LX9A4ys6i4nzHtpOLNLodKK